Thanks to a planning application for 75 houses on the site adjacent to these allotments, I discovered their existence, less than a mile from my home. I had no idea they was there. I also had no idea we have slow worms in the area either, something else I discovered thanks to an ecological report attached to the application.

I intend to comment on the submission and will do so in the next day or two, but haven't decided whether on balance it is a good thing or bad. Two of the aspects I have decided on though. Firstly, the sketches showing both the density of proposed housing and its style are hideously inappropriate. Secondly the local area is very short of untouched open spaces such as this and we could do with keeping it.

Anyhow, back to the picture. This fella has got his work cut out, fending off local bird life and twitchy nosed rodents. This glorious weather is going to fry these veggies before long - perhaps he's going to need to take up rain dancing too??
